Transaction 70168f065b651eb24d4dd1f7a42e87c125bebb86257f25e494545dffb02d2f2f
1 Input
2 Outputs
- 70168f065b651eb24d4dd1f7a42e87c125bebb86257f25e494545dffb02d2f2f:0
- 70168f065b651eb24d4dd1f7a42e87c125bebb86257f25e494545dffb02d2f2f:1
value 4000000
address 3BY3srfPuC16yoAZYn7meRY4KSaYFmZL1F
value 6079577
address 18x9NuWjyzQrEXVpNo45LCYmLvQpdzxK35